Configuring an Alternate SysDB

There is no need to configure an alternate SysDB for testing purposes. But if you wish
to completely segregate environments, you may configure an alternate system
database by performing the following steps:

1.

Add the SysDB define

2.

Create the alternate SysDB

3.

Enter your AutoSYNC license

4.

Create an alternate MapDB
